Lucian, you're from Trimaris, right? Don't worry, you'll be fine. Maybe have a nice big meal, preferably something heavy like turkey and mashed potatoes before every battle. If your body says you really need a nap, listen to it. :wink:
Seriously, my arms can feel like lead if I haven't fought in a while. I generally pick up a couple 5 to 10lb weights and pretend I'm throwing shots and blocking with them in my hands for as many reps as I can, then rest for a couple minutes and repeat. Do that for a few days and you'll fare much better. Staying hydrated, stretching and adding a bit of muscle can reduce your injuries. Check over your whole kit well before it's time to go to make sure everything is in good shape and still fits.
